An easy way to answer this problem is to find the mid-point between the two given points, namely ( (4-2)/2, (1-11)/2 )=(1,-5).
Another way is to find a line through the two points, and select any point on the line.
Slope = (1-(-11))/(4-(-2))=12/6=2
Then use the point slope form to find the line:
y-1=2(x-4) which can be simplified to
y=2x-7
Put x=0, y=-7 => (0,-7)
Put x=1, y=-5 => (1, -5) [ as above ]
Put x=2, y=-3 => (2, -3)

Step-by-step explanation:
5x + 7y = 10 → (1)
- 9x + y = 50 ( add 9x to both sides )
y = 9x + 50 → (2)
substitute y = 9x + 50 into (1)
5x + 7(9x + 50) = 10
5x + 63x + 350 = 10 ( subtract 350 from both sides )
68x = - 340 ( divide both sides by 68 )
x = - 5
substitute x = - 5 into (2)
y = 9(- 5) + 50 = - 45 + 50 = 5
solution is (- 5, 5 )
